Job Summary

Our Employment Specialists work closely with individuals who experience a disability to ensure our services reflect their wishes, needs, abilities and employment goals. The Employment Specialist/Job Coach will work directly with clients and their employers at the job site, they also work with individuals to learn and maintain all needed ancillary skills to ensure successful ongoing employment. We also provide support to individuals to become full participating members of their community.

Responsibilities and Duties

Assist clients to discover and build skills to overcome barriers and set goals.

Network with local businesses to develop employment opportunities for individuals with developmental disabilities.

Assess the strengths of each job seeker and assist them to learn to use them.

Provide job coaching for designing and using effective job search techniques.

Advise on workplace accommodations for individuals with disabilities.

Develop effective employment and coaching plans for each individual.

Monitor and evaluate progress of clients.

Maintain up-to-date contact notes, case records and other assigned paperwork.

Provide training to support the participant and employer through job, task, or schedule changes.

Identify and implement solutions to transportation problems as needed.

Coordinate with residential staff or families when needed.

Establish and maintain positive relationships with the individual, employer, and other supports. Communicate any personnel issues with P, J & A supervisor.

Attend weekly staff meetings. Provide input to other staff and volunteer to share responsibilities that contribute to the success of the team.

Participate in client review sessions with representatives of involved agencies, families or chosen advocates. Assist with establishing annual service plan goals.

Develop ongoing positive relationships with key co-workers in the participants place of employment.

Carry out additional responsibilities as identified.
